AST SpaceMobile (NASDAQ:ASTS) Announces Earnings Results

AST SpaceMobile (NASDAQ:ASTSGet Free Report) posted its earnings results on Monday. The company reported ($0.77) E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.32) by ($0.45), FiscalAI reports. AST SpaceMobile had a negative return on equity of 24.87% and a negative net margin of 573.67%.The firm had revenue of $31.52 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$34.98 million. During the same quarter last year, the company posted ($0.41) EPS.

Here are the key takeaways from AST SpaceMobile’s conference call:

  • Q2 revenue more than doubled sequentially to $31.5 million, driven by commercial gateway deliveries and U.S. government milestones. Management reiterated full-year 2026 revenue guidance of $150 million–$200 million, with revenue expected to increase each quarter and be weighted toward Q4.
  • The company reported approximately $1.3 billion in revenue backlog and more than $3.7 billion of pro forma cash, equivalents, and restricted cash. It also announced three U.S. government contract awards with more than $100 million of funded value expected in 2026–2027 and said government revenue could become a recurring multibillion-dollar annual opportunity beginning in 2027.
  • Commercial deployment continued to advance, with more than 60 mobile network operator partners representing over 3 billion subscribers, approximately 50 gateways in various stages across 20 markets, and a target of roughly 45 BlueBird satellites in orbit by early 2027. Management is targeting consumer beta availability later in 2026 and commercial service with approximately 45 satellites.
  • AST SpaceMobile received a preliminary selection for Japan’s J-LEO project, which could provide up to approximately $1 billion in non-dilutive, non-debt government capital, while expanding opportunities in radar, secure government communications, emergency response, IoT, and AI edge computing.
  • Growth requires substantial spending: Q2 adjusted operating expenses excluding cost of revenues rose to $95.9 million, capital expenditures reached approximately $610 million, and Q3 adjusted operating expenses are expected to increase to $105 million–$115 million. The 2026 revenue plan remains dependent on successful satellite launches, gateway deliveries, and contract milestones.

AST SpaceMobile Trading Down 4.4%

Shares of ASTS stock opened at $68.76 on Tuesday. The stock has a 50-day simple moving average of $75.22 and a 200 day simple moving average of $85.69. The stock has a market capitalization of $26.69 billion, a P/E ratio of -38.63 and a beta of 2.76. AST SpaceMobile has a fifty-two week low of $36.08 and a fifty-two week high of $133.86. The company has a quick ratio of 18.37, a current ratio of 18.47 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.11.

Insiders Place Their Bets

In related news, Director Julio A. Torres sold 15,000 shares of the stock in a transaction that occurred on Wednesday, May 13th. The shares were sold at an average price of $76.34, for a total transaction of $1,145,100.00. Following the completion of the sale, the director directly owned 43,239 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$3,300,865.26. This represents a 25.76%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available at the SEC website. Also, CTO Huiwen Yao sold 40,000 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Friday, June 5th. The stock was sold at an average price of $96.37, for a total transaction of $3,854,800.00. Following the sale, the chief technology officer owned 34,750 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$3,348,857.50. The trade was a 53.51%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The SEC filing for this sale provides additional information.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. Over the last three months, insiders have sold 105,809 shares of company stock worth $9,748,492. 20.89% of the stock is owned by corporate insiders.

AST SpaceMobile Company Profile

AST SpaceMobile is a U.S.-based aerospace company developing a space-based cellular broadband network designed to connect standard mobile phones and other devices directly to satellites. The company’s core proposition is “space-to-cell” service: operating a constellation of low-Earth-orbit (LEO) satellites equipped with large, high-power phased-array antennas to provide wide-area mobile broadband without requiring users to buy specialized terminals or handset modifications.

AST SpaceMobile designs, builds and operates satellite payloads and supporting ground infrastructure.
